Garage Door Banging Noise

Banging sounds are often caused by unbalanced doors.  It's important to get this issue repaired sooner rather than later to prevent other damage from taking place.

Weather Stripping Repair

As your garage door ages, the weather stripping or trim may break down and need repair.  Repairing the weather stripping will help insulate your garage and keep unwanted animals out.

Rattling Garage Door Sounds

Rattling noises may be due to lo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ing greasing , misaligned doors, or a garage door opener that was not correctly installed.

Garage Door Scraping Sounds

Scraping sounds are sometimes due to misaligned doors.

Squeaking Garage Door

Squeaking sounds might be caused by a loose roller or hinge, parts needing oiling, or unbalanced doors.

Rubbing Sound Garage Door

Rubbing could be the result of b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s fixing.

Grinding Sound Garage Door

Grinding noises might be caused by parts needing grease,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an incorrectly installed opener.

Slapping Garage Door Sound

Slapping noises are often caused by a loose chain.

Vibrating Garage Door Noise

Vibrating noises are frequently caused by loose parts or rollers needing lubrication.

Popping Noise Garage Door

Popping noises could be the result of torsion spring issues.

Garage Door Opener Installation

The standard lifespan of a garage door opener is roughly 10-15 years. Routine upkeep, lubrication, and making sure your garage door is in balance will increase the lifespan of your opener. For safety and security reasons, if you have a garage door opener which was built before 1993, it’s recommended to have it replaced and not repaired.
